For centuries, royal women in (private quarters) used food as a medium of wisdom, planning meals around seasons, health, and temperament. They created recipes like slow-cooked stews and healing sweets that outlived their palaces, eventually becoming everyday classics across India. For many women today, the kitchen remains a powerful domain, though a complex one. While some women are actively remaking rituals around food, exploring their own relationships with it, others still face restrictions, such as the inability to eat certain foods due to household dietary rules or even being excluded from meals until all men have finished eating.

Education has been the single most powerful tool for changing the lifestyle of Indian women. Over the last few decades, literacy rates and higher education enrollment among women have soared. Indian women are entering ST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ics) fields in unprecedented numbers, graduating at higher rates in these sectors than in many Western nations.
